Understanding Narcissism

Before we delve into the questions, let’s first understand what narcissism is. Narcissism is a personality disorder characterized by a sense of grandiosity, a lack of empathy, and a need for admiration. People with narcissistic traits often have an inflated sense of self-importance and a strong desire for validation from others. They may manipulate, exploit, or belittle those around them to maintain their self-image.

The Power of Questions

Asking questions is a powerful way to challenge a narcissist’s behavior and beliefs. By posing thoughtful and probing questions, you can disrupt their narrative, expose their insecurities, and potentially shift the dynamic of the conversation in your favor. Here are the top 10 questions to stump every narcissist you encounter:

1. "Can you tell me about a time when you failed?"

Narcissists often struggle with admitting their faults or vulnerabilities. Asking them to recount a failure can catch them off guard and potentially reveal their true attitude towards setbacks and imperfections.

2. "How do you think your actions impact others?"

Narcissists tend to be self-absorbed and may not consider the consequences of their behavior on others. This question challenges them to reflect on their impact and promotes empathy, which is a trait they often lack.

3. "What do you think is your biggest weakness?"

Narcissists are known for projecting a strong, flawless image to the world. Asking about their weaknesses can challenge their facade and prompt them to acknowledge areas where they may fall short.

4. "How do you handle criticism?"

Narcissists often react poorly to criticism, viewing it as a personal attack. This question can reveal their defensiveness and lack of ability to accept feedback constructively.

5. "Do you think you could benefit from therapy or counseling?"

Suggesting therapy or counseling to a narcissist can be a direct challenge to their self-perception of superiority. This question can expose their resistance to seeking help and addressing underlying issues.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Can narcissists change their behavior?

A1: While change is possible, it is rare for narcissists to seek therapy or actively work on improving themselves.

Q2: How do narcissists manipulate others?

A2: Narcissists often manipulate through gaslighting, guilt-tripping, and playing the victim.

Q3: Are all arrogant people narcissists?

A3: Not all arrogant individuals are narcissists, but narcissists typically exhibit arrogance as a defining trait.

Q4: What are the red flags of narcissistic behavior in a relationship?

A4: Red flags include a lack of empathy, constant need for validation, and emotional manipulation.

Q5: Can narcissists have successful relationships?

A5: Narcissists can struggle to maintain healthy relationships due to their selfishness and lack of empathy.
